Overview
- The Detroit Pistons defeated the New York Knicks 100-94 in Game 2, tying the first-round playoff series at 1-1.
- OG Anunoby, who scored 32 points in Game 1, was limited to just 10 points in Game 2 while struggling to contain Pistons star Cade Cunningham.
- Cade Cunningham led the Pistons with 33 points and 12 rebounds, dominating both offensively and defensively in Game 2.
- Olympic gymnast Suni Lee attended Game 2 courtside at Madison Square Garden, continuing the playful superstition about her being a good luck charm for Anunoby.
- The series now shifts to Detroit for Game 3, with attention on whether the Knicks can regain momentum and adjust their strategy.
